Industry: Agriculture

Main economic activity

2/3 of working population- Subsistence farming- Shifting farming- Commercial farming

Shifting farming

Farmers move every 1-3 years for better soil - slash and burn

Commercial Farming

Small percentage - many foreign owned Focus on cash crops for export - cacao, coffee and

Industry: Mining

South Africa - world’s largest gold producer

Diamonds, coal, platinum, chromium

Page 20: Modern Day Industries and Economic Challenges in SSA

Challenges: Mining Foreign investors

reap most benefit from mines

Uneven distribution of mineral resources

Most resources along equator and Atlantic coast

Industry: Manufacturing

Small % of GDP Industrial expansion

began in 1960s Process food Textiles Leather products Assembly plants

(airplanes, cars, motors)

Page 24: Modern Day Industries and Economic Challenges in SSA

Challenge: Industrialization

Many countries never developed manufacturing industries - Why??

Most countries act as suppliers of raw materials

Lack of skilled workers

Power shortages
